They also control your resistance without any input, as you go up a hill, it’ll get harder, and when you go down, it’ll be easier. These models send all the data needed your heart rate, wattage, speed, distance and more directly, with no need to use external devices. These are the bikes that are fully compatible with Zwift and provide the best Zwift gaming experience.
